Does men liposuction have a long recovery time?

Liposuction recovery times vary based on the area being altered. A general time frame is that recovery can take anywhere from a 2-3 weeks up to 3 months for the swelling to go down.


HN Miller will experience a wide range of short- and long-time psychological reactions to the assault with?

It is common for individuals who have experienced assault to undergo a variety of psychological reactions, both in the short and long term. Short-term reactions may include shock, fear, and anxiety, while long-term reactions could manifest as post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), depression, and difficulties in trusting others. It is important for HN Miller to seek support from mental health professionals to address these reactions and work towards healing and recovery.
